The Dangers of Neglecting a Blocked Drain and What You Should Do
Dealing with a blocked drain can be frustrating, and it’s always best to catch the problem early. We have compiled a list with signs to watch for when you are dealing with blocked drains.
Slow Draining
Blockages can occur when your bathtub or sink drains slower than usual. This is the most obvious sign of a blocked drain. It could be caused by something as simple as a buildup of hair, soap, or grease.
Foul Odors
A blockage in your pipes can cause foul odors from your drains. The smell could be caused by anything from rotting food stuck in your kitchen sink to organic matter caught in your bathroom’s waste pipe.
Strange Noises
Gurgling noises coming from your pipes is another clear sign that you may have a blocked drain. These sounds are often heard when water drains from toilets and sinks. They’re often caused by trapped air trying desperately to escape through the blockage.
Water Backing Up
A blocked drain is when water backs up in other fixtures, such as sinks or toilets, or when you use appliances like washing machines or dishwashers. Water backup can cause flooding if left untreated.
How to Deal with a Blockage
We’ve already covered the signs of a blocked drain, but let’s now look at what to do if yours is causing problems.
- Use A Plunger To clear small blockages in your pipes, a plunger is a good choice.
- Pour Boiling water: Pouring boiling hot water down the drain can break down soap scum, and help melt any grease or fats.
- Use a store-bought Drain cleaner. These can cause damage to pipes over time. You can also make your own drain cleaner with baking soda and vinegar.
If none of these solutions work it is time to call a professional plumber. They’ll have the expertise and tools to find and remove any blockages from your pipes.
